Gentoo Archives: gentoo-commits

From: "Kacper Kowalik (xarthisius)" <xarthisius@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in sys-cluster/slurm: slurm-2.3.4.ebuild ChangeLog
Date: Thu, 23 Aug 2012 09:37:01
Message-Id: 20120823093649.6D08D2043C@flycatcher.gentoo.org
1 xarthisius 12/08/23 09:36:49
2
3 Modified: slurm-2.3.4.ebuild ChangeLog
4 Log:
5 Add missing inherit of user.eclass for enew{group,user}. Fix building with glibc-2.16 wrt #430252 by Diego Elio Pettenò <flameeyes@g.o>
6
7 (Portage version: 2.2.0_alpha121/cvs/Linux x86_64)
8
9 Revision Changes Path
10 1.4 sys-cluster/slurm/slurm-2.3.4.ebuild
11
12 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/slurm/slurm-2.3.4.ebuild?rev=1.4&view=markup
13 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/slurm/slurm-2.3.4.ebuild?rev=1.4&content-type=text/plain
14 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/slurm/slurm-2.3.4.ebuild?r1=1.3&r2=1.4
15
16 Index: slurm-2.3.4.ebuild
17 ===================================================================
18 RCS file: /var/cvsroot/gentoo-x86/sys-cluster/slurm/slurm-2.3.4.ebuild,v
19 retrieving revision 1.3
20 retrieving revision 1.4
21 diff -u -r1.3 -r1.4
22 --- slurm-2.3.4.ebuild 9 May 2012 07:37:21 -0000 1.3
23 +++ slurm-2.3.4.ebuild 23 Aug 2012 09:36:49 -0000 1.4
24 @@ -1,11 +1,11 @@
25 # Copyright 1999-2012 Gentoo Foundation
26 # Distributed under the terms of the GNU General Public License v2
27 -# $Header: /var/cvsroot/gentoo-x86/sys-cluster/slurm/slurm-2.3.4.ebuild,v 1.3 2012/05/09 07:37:21 zmedico Exp $
28 +# $Header: /var/cvsroot/gentoo-x86/sys-cluster/slurm/slurm-2.3.4.ebuild,v 1.4 2012/08/23 09:36:49 xarthisius Exp $
29
30 EAPI=4
31 RESTRICT="primaryuri"
32
33 -inherit eutils versionator pam perl-module
34 +inherit eutils versionator pam perl-module user
35
36 MY_PV=$(replace_version_separator 3 '-') # stable releases
37 #MY_PV=$(replace_version_separator 3 '-0.') # pre-releases
38 @@ -71,6 +71,8 @@
39 sed -e 's:/tmp:/var/tmp:g' \
40 -i "${S}/etc/slurm.conf.example" \
41 || die "Can't sed for StateSaveLocation=*./tmp"
42 +
43 + epatch "${FILESDIR}"/${P}-glibc2.16.patch
44 }
45
46 src_configure() {
47
48
49
50 1.13 sys-cluster/slurm/ChangeLog
51
52 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/slurm/ChangeLog?rev=1.13&view=markup
53 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/slurm/ChangeLog?rev=1.13&content-type=text/plain
54 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-cluster/slurm/ChangeLog?r1=1.12&r2=1.13
55
56 Index: ChangeLog
57 ===================================================================
58 RCS file: /var/cvsroot/gentoo-x86/sys-cluster/slurm/ChangeLog,v
59 retrieving revision 1.12
60 retrieving revision 1.13
61 diff -u -r1.12 -r1.13
62 --- ChangeLog 9 May 2012 07:37:21 -0000 1.12
63 +++ ChangeLog 23 Aug 2012 09:36:49 -0000 1.13
64 @@ -1,6 +1,11 @@
65 # ChangeLog for sys-cluster/slurm
66 #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
67 -# $Header: /var/cvsroot/gentoo-x86/sys-cluster/slurm/ChangeLog,v 1.12 2012/05/09 07:37:21 zmedico Exp $
68 +# $Header: /var/cvsroot/gentoo-x86/sys-cluster/slurm/ChangeLog,v 1.13 2012/08/23 09:36:49 xarthisius Exp $
69 +
70 + 23 Aug 2012; Kacper Kowalik <xarthisius@g.o>
71 + +files/slurm-2.3.4-glibc2.16.patch, slurm-2.3.4.ebuild:
72 + Add missing inherit of user.eclass for enew{group,user}. Fix building with
73 + glibc-2.16 wrt #430252 by Diego Elio Pettenò <flameeyes@g.o>
74
75 09 May 2012; Zac Medico <zmedico@g.o> slurm-2.3.4.ebuild:
76 Move EAPI assignment to top of ebuild, bug 411875.
77 @@ -57,4 +62,3 @@
78 +files/slurm.confd, +files/slurmctld.initd, +files/slurmd.initd,
79 +files/slurmdbd.initd, +metadata.xml:
80 Initial import
81 -